Transaction 7504b7839f8233738bd5adf37058441916402ca214935142bdeee45d78ae8058
1 Input
1 Output
-
7504b7839f8233738bd5adf37058441916402ca214935142bdeee45d78ae8058:0
- value
- 5004323
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 74625c8318f8425a036bc735085706f70746e820 OP_EQUAL
- address
- 3CJQ94gR2vrvPCJ1Tt2iBTmB4m5tXtuY6y